摘要
介绍了垃圾焚烧发电厂设计时在位移控制方面所面临的问题。以某垃圾焚烧处理项目进行位移计算分析。根据结构上各种荷载的特点,简化设计了几种工况,包含吊车和温度作用以及平面框排架分析。对比了各种工况下的位移及杆端位移比,总结了结构在各种荷载下主要位移特点,并对某些部位位移反应大的情况给出了设计建议。
The problem of displacement control in design of waste incineration power plant was introduced.The displacement of a waste incineration power plant project was calculated and analyzed.According to the deformation effect characteristics of various loads on the structure,several working conditions were simplified,including crane,temperature effect and plane frame-bent analysis.By comparing the displacement and the displacement ratio of the bar end under various working conditions,the main displacement characteristics of the structure under various loads were summarized,and the design suggestions for the displacement response of some parts were given.
